The Growing Use of Aluminium in Automobiles
Over the last decade, aluminium has gained significant importance in the manufacturing of vehicles. Automakers are increasingly incorporating aluminium in car bodies, frames, and panels because of its lightweight properties, strength, and resistance to corrosion. Aluminium helps improve fuel efficiency, reduce emissions, and enhance overall performance, making it an ideal material for modern cars, especially electric vehicles (EVs).
However, repairing aluminium is not the same as repairing traditional steel. Aluminium requires specialized handling due to its different chemical and physical properties. For instance, aluminium dust can pose fire risks, and contamination between aluminium and steel can lead to corrosion problems. These challenges make aluminium automotive repair booths a necessity for repair shops handling advanced vehicles.
Why Specialized Booths Are Required for Aluminium Repairs
A standard automotive spray booth is highly effective for general refinishing jobs, but it may not provide the level of isolation and safety needed for aluminium repair. Aluminium requires a separate, controlled environment to ensure the repair process is safe and contamination-free.
Here are the key reasons why specialized aluminium repair booths are essential:
Contamination Control – Aluminium repairs must be kept separate from steel repairs to avoid galvanic corrosion. Dedicated booths ensure there is no cross-contamination of materials.
Safety Against Fire Hazards – Aluminium dust particles are highly flammable. A specialized booth with proper extraction and filtration systems reduces fire risks.
Precision Finishing – A controlled airflow and temperature environment in the booth ensures smooth and defect-free paint application.
Compliance with Regulations – Many regions mandate dedicated aluminium repair facilities to meet health, safety, and environmental standards.
Key Features of Aluminium Automotive Repair Booths
Specialized booths for aluminium repairs are engineered with unique features that distinguish them from standard spray booths. Some of these include:
Dedicated Ventilation Systems: High-performance extraction systems prevent accumulation of aluminium dust and maintain clean air.
Dust Collection Units: Industrial-grade filtration systems capture particles to avoid fire hazards and contamination.
Temperature and Humidity Control: These systems ensure optimal curing conditions for aluminium panels during refinishing.
Fire-Safe Construction: Materials used in the booth’s construction are designed to withstand potential ignition risks.
Sealed Work Environments: The booth prevents external dust and contaminants from interfering with the refinishing process.
By incorporating these features, aluminium repair booths provide an advanced version of an automotive spray booth, tailored specifically for sensitive and specialized applications.
